Output 83a2b4139287971de7927f05d3e2b291c0c4ad6c1341c7bd1ba84e541cb2283a:25

value
16584825
script pubkey
OP_0 OP_PUSHBYTES_20 f918dd3b0d34bad22cfa6581024611f45cb98695
address
ltc1qlyvd6wcdxjadyt86vkqsy3s373wtnp5432l6h5
transaction
83a2b4139287971de7927f05d3e2b291c0c4ad6c1341c7bd1ba84e541cb2283a
spent
true